    Can I watch Netflix on TC-P65ST60
    ferdinand.parker
    over 1 year ago
    TC-P65ST60 doesn't have smart TV, but if you do not have a smart TV, you can still watch Netflix on your TV. To do so, you will need to connect a streaming device to it that allows you to stream online content. Some options for doing this include streaming sticks, set-top boxes, and Blu-ray players with built-in streaming capabilities. Once connected, you will be able to stream content from Netflix and other platforms on your non-smart TV.
